Show that you support the Emergency Medical Services (EMS) who risk their lives to save yours and submit your name to get it printed on an ambulance.

Every day Emergency Medical Services staff risk their lives to save others – and it is now time for us to show we value their dedicated services. Thousands of people in your community are adding their names to show their commitment to protecting EMS staff who are being attacked and robbed on a daily basis.

Show that you are In Support of Life, by adding your name, and telling EMS staff that they are valued and that you will help them continue to save lives and get your name printed on an ambulance.

I promise to protect Emergency Medical Services staff

I promise to report any information I have on criminals

I promise to respect Emergency Medical Services staff

And I promise to tell my friends and family to support and protect Emergency Medical Services staff

Sign up to stand by Emergency Medical Services today.
